Consider a value to be significantly low if its z score less than or equal to minus 2 or consider a value to be significantly hi

gh if its z score is greater than or equal to 2. A test is used to assess readiness for college. In a recent​ year, the mean test score was 21.6 and the standard deviation was 5.4. Identify the test scores that are significantly low or significantly high. What test scores are significantly​ low?

Answer:

The scores that are less than or equal to 10.8 are considered significantly low.

The scores that are greater than or equal to 32.4 are considered significantly high.

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given the following information in the question:

Mean, μ = 21.6

Standard Deviation, σ = 5.4

We are given that the distribution of score is a bell shaped distribution that is a normal distribution.

Formula:

z_{score} = \displaystyle\frac{x-\mu}{\sigma}

Significantly low score:

z \leq -2\\z = \displaystyle\frac{x-21.6}{5.4} \leq -2\\\\\displaystyle\frac{x-21.6}{5.4} \leq -2\\\\x\leq -2(5.4) + 21.6\\\Rightarrow x \leq 10.8

Thus, scores that are less than or equal to 10.8 are considered significantly low.

Significantly high score:

z \geq 2\\z = \displaystyle\frac{x-21.6}{5.4} \geq 2\\\\\displaystyle\frac{x-21.6}{5.4} \geq 2\\\\x\geq 2(5.4) + 21.6\\\Rightarrow x \geq 32.4

Thus, scores that are greater than or equal to 32.4 are considered significantly high.

How do you translate the graph of f(x) = x3 left 4 units and down 2 units? Identify the equation of the graph
Marina CMI [18]

Answer:

The correct option is B.

Step-by-step explanation:

The given function is

f(x)=x^3

The translation of a function is defined as

g(x)=f(x+a)+b

If a>0, then the graph of f(x) shift a units left and if a<0, then the graph of f(x) shift a units right.

If b>0, then the graph of f(x) shift b units up and if b<0, then the graph of f(x) shift b units down.

It is given that the graph of f(x) shifts 4 units left and 2 units down.  So, a=4 and b=-2.

g(x)=f(x+4)+(-2)

g(x)=(x+4)^3-2              [\because f(x)=x^3]

y=(x+4)^3-2

Therefore option B is correct.
